Lincoln Debuts Star Concept SUV, Has 4 Electric SUVs In The Works

- The new concept will be the basis for 4 EVs that Lincoln is developing
- 3 EVs will show up in 2025 while the 4th will come in 2026
- Lincoln is aggressively pursing futuristic concepts
Ford's premier brand Lincoln brand has debuted a futuristic Star SUV concept which will be based on an all-electric power train. The "Star" concept will be the basis of four electric SUVs it is planning to release between 2025 and 2026. Thereof these cars will be launched in 2025 and the fourth one will come in 2026.
The car propagates a design language that is admittedly very futuristic but it is something that could be translated to a production vehicle by 2025. It will also come with its own digital assistant. Some of the salient features of this concept include the use of light, displays, scents, and sounds to create an immersive environment.

This concept will be the basis for four Lincoln SUVs
Lincoln is debuting a new intelligence system that enables connected vehicle to vehicle and infrastructure capabilities and driver assistant features like "Help me see" and "Park for me". The interior will be based on extra spacious wraparound seating which will have recliners akin to a lounge-like vibe and individual lounge rests and storage for all kinds of devices and slippers.
The car also has controls for three rejuvenation moods and a glass beverage chiller between the back seat. On the front, the vehicle gets a curved panoramic display which fifers content that seamlessly gets integrated into the center infotainment display and then on to the second-row screen.
There is also a frunk which has covered with electro-chromatic glass that changes from transparent to opaque.
"As Lincoln enters the next chapter in our transition to a zero-emissions future, the Lincoln Star Concept will lead the way for our portfolio of fully electric vehicles. It is an excellent example of how we are redefining luxury for the next generation as we work to transform the vehicle into a third space - a true place of sanctuary - for our clients," said Lincoln president, Jay Falotico.
